Lake County Master Planned Community

Description: 166 AC Master Planned Community w/ Commercial, Multifamily, Build-To-Rent, Townhomes, and Single Family
Project Details
  • Market: Orlando MSA (Lake County, FL)
  • Project Type: Master Development
  • Role: Due Diligence / Entitlements & Governmental Approvals / Project Management

Background

Situated in one of Central Florida’s fastest-growing counties, this property offered ample land and excellent transportation access, making it ideal for a master-planned community. Although the local jurisdiction had designated the area for future development, the recently approved comprehensive plan had yet to be utilized, especially on a project of this magnitude.

The Challenge

  • Create a land assemblage of over 166 acres amongst 4 different ownership groups
  • Develop a master plan that met current market demands while also utilizing a newly approved comprehensive plan within the local municipality

The PLD Approach

  • Conducted multiple collaborative meetings with planning staff design a master development that both met the cities vision for that area and the current market demands
  • Hold community meetings with surrounding neighbors to address any concerns and eventually earn their recommendation for approval of the project

The Outcome

We successfully obtained full approval for the master-planned community, incorporating a mix of commercial, multifamily, build-to-rent, and single-family homes, while staying true to the area’s original vision.
